> On another note, how much quotes would you allow before it's too long?

Discretion is the key here. A good rule is that if the reader ends up
having to scroll to get to your text below an quoted text block then
too much quoting has been done.

I also feel conscious of sending a message that has far more quoted
text than replied text. It's a carefully deliberated action on my part
and has to be soundly justified. Far more quoted text for me is say
more than double the amount of original text.
